What are GLP-1 drugs?

Medications that look like 1 or GLP-1, developed about 20 years ago to help people with diabetes manage blood glucose levels, have also been found to promote significant weight loss. These drugs, which mimic the natural GLP-1 hormone, not only cause insulin release but also slow empty and reinforce feelings of fullness, leading to reduced calorie intake.

It is usually administered by injection to adipose tissue, GLP-1s can lead to a 10-20%weight loss, depending on the specific drug used. In addition to weight loss, they offer numerous health benefits, including lower blood pressure, reduced risk of heart and kidney disease, and improvements in oily liver disease and diabetes -related kidney damage.

Management of common side effects

GLP-1 fighters can cause a series of side effects, including the strong loss of appetite, n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, dizziness, increased heart rate, headaches and indigestion. The most serious but less common risks include pancreatitis, acute kidney damage, retinopathy and thyroid cancer. Despite these challenges, people taking GLP-1 drugs for weight loss often adopt healthier diets3, consume more fruits, vegetables, fish, poultry, dairy products and meat, as the appetite decreases and gives priority to nutrient density. For the management of symptoms, it is recommended to eat small portions each time, incorporate foods rich and increase liquids.

Some of the main shortages of vitamin and minerals for people on GLP-1 drugs include:

  • Vitamin B-12
  • Calcium
  • Vitamin d

3) calcium

This important bone health mineral is found in foods such as milk and dairy products, reinforced soy milk and yogurt, enhanced tofu, dark leafy greens and beans. However, guidelines for Americans 2020-20254 Determine calcium as a nutrient of concern. As people on GLP-1 drugs have limited appetite, they tend not to respond to daily calcium recommendations and are at risk of calcium deficiency. 4) Vitamin D

Vitamin D works with calcium to help maintain bone health – plus vitamin helps to regulate many other cellular functions in your body. This vitamin is another formally subjective nutrient as identified by dietary guidelines for Americans4. While you can get some vitamin D by exposing your skin to sunlight outdoors (without sunscreen), you should look for sources of vitamin D food, which are rather limited. Vitamin D food sources include egg yolks, garden liver oil and reinforced milk. A simple blood test can help you determine if you are insufficient and requires vitamin D-especially if you are in GLP-1 drugs.
